Send us a text [https://www.buzzsprout.com/twilio/text_messages/2036716/open_sms] Software projects are infamous for the "Death March"...the ever increasing demand for effort to "catch up" a slipping project. More and more effort actually reduces efficiency and often leads to further slippage, creating a cycle that is tough to escape and can lead to Burnout. How can you avoid it? Let's talk about it...
